I just received a flyer in the mail from Infosphere promoting their soon to
be released product 'LASERSERVE: "The Spooler You've Been Waiting For"'. At
a SRP of $125 per workstation, its probably not what a lof of us have 'been
waiting for', though it sounds very good.

It's scheduled for release on October 31st and offers many features (con-
densed from their newsletter);
   * Operates in the background - no dedicated hardware required
   * Users without LaserServe do not lose printing capabilities
   * Works on Mac Plus, 512 and XL
   * Serves LaserWriter (and compatibles) and AppleTalk ImageWriters
   * Uses standard printer drivers.
   * Works as a desk accessory
   * Has "direct print" and "priority service" options.
   * Can use floppy, local hard disk or network server for spool files
   * Up to 16 print jobs at a time with queue ordering and individual
      job control.
   * Uses "pop-up" dialog messages; print complete/problem report.
   * Spools to multiple printers
   * Remebers configuration choices and auto-installs
   * Has a "fail-safe" design; print jobs saved on disk till completed
